Microsoft Azure DevOps Server Markdown Indexing Deserialization of Untrusted Data Remote Code Execution Vulnerability

VULNERABILITY DETAILS

This vulnerability allows remote attackers to execute arbitrary code on affected installations of Microsoft Azure DevOps Server. Authentication is required to exploit this vulnerability.

The specific flaw exists within the processing of markdown files during indexing of wiki content. A crafted document uploaded to a wiki can trigger the deserialization of untrusted data. An attacker can leverage this vulnerability to execute code in the context of LOCAL SERVICE.
